When you set up your own TMW server and want it to be open for public playing feel free to add it here. To create your own server read Setting up a server. All servers/projects on this page work with the official client. Servers/Projects listed on forks are incompatible with the official TMW client, though they are based on it.

eAthena servers for 0.0.x clients

These servers run on eAthena. You can connect to them with a client compiled from the 0.0 branch or with any 0.0.x release.

TMWServ servers for 0.1 client

You can connect to these servers with a client compiled from trunk. Note that TMWServ is still in development and doesn't offer real gameplay yet. As a player you will have much more fun with the 0.0.x client on an eAthena server.

Official test server

The semi-official test server for the new server tmwserv. The server runs in gdb so that we'll even have a chance of finding those rare crashes, but hence may not always be available.

Invertika server

A German fork of TMW based on tmwserv with a completely new game world. The server is in alpha status. Downtimes are possible.
